The most prestigious club competition in Europe is back this Wednesday. 20 players who took part in the Sud Ladies Cup will compete in the Champions League this season. Recap !
Sixteen teams will compete to reach their dream : win the Champions League. A highly coveted trophy but the favorites are obviously the title holders, Olympique Lyonnais. The eight-time European champions are aiming to retain their trophy. To reach their goal, Lyon can count on Selma Bacha who seems unstoppable this moment. After impressing at the Euro this summer with France, the 22-year-old versatile Frenchwoman has finished 14th at the 2022 Ballon d’Or this week.

Among the other title contenders, we find Paris Saint-Germain. Semi-finalists last season (after a defeat against… Lyon !), the Parisians will be able to rely on their several rising stars in order to achieve the ultimate goal. Even if their superstar Marie-Antoinette Katoto is sidelined for several months after being injured at the 2022 Euro, PSG will be led by several France internationals including Sandy Baltimore, Elisa de Almeida as well as Oriane Jean-François. Without forgetting the promising Laurina Fazer, named as the 2022 Sud Ladies Cup best player and recently called-up to the France senior national team.

Also, the observers will keep an eye on the Bayern Munich of Klara Bühl and will monitor the rise of Real Madrid. The Spaniards have notably signed the highly-rated teenage forward Naomie Feller this summer

The 20 Sud Ladies Cup graduates to compete in the 2022/2023 Champions League
Bayern Munich : Janina Leitzig, Klara Bühl, Emelyne Laurent
Juventus : Annahita Zamanian
Lyon : Alice Sombath, Kysha Sylla, Selma Bacha, Vicki Becho
Paris Saint-Germain : Océane Toussaint, Elisa De Almeida, Magnaba Folquet, Baby Jordy Benera, Oriane Jean-François, Laurina Fazer, Sandy Baltimore, Manssita Traore, Marie-Antoinette Katoto
Real Madrid : Naomie Feller
Rosengard : Stefanie Sanders
Zurich : Marion Rey
